Output de68cae7581b902b801e8c87f6c41420336964e18f01f594ad5d84d0d9a40708:181

value
101986916
script pubkey
OP_0 OP_PUSHBYTES_20 e88e363852255405c075c67bb6e3d5483151bec2
address
ltc1qaz8rvwzjy42qtsr4ceamdc74fqc4r0kzxcj74g
transaction
de68cae7581b902b801e8c87f6c41420336964e18f01f594ad5d84d0d9a40708
spent
true